S. Weir Mitchell'Äôs "A Madeira Party" intricately weaves a narrative that captures the complexities of human relationships against the vibrant backdrop of a social gathering. Utilizing a keen observational style, Mitchell delves into the subtleties of conversation and emotion, presenting characters that resonate with both authenticity and depth. The book, set amidst the political and social undertones of the late 19th century, employs witty dialogue and richly descriptive passages that enhance the reader'Äôs engagement with the themes of societal expectations and personal desires. Mitchell, a prominent physician and writer, draws on his extensive medical background and experiences in Victorian society to create a nuanced exploration of character psychology. His dual perspective as a healer and a keen social observer allows him to dissect the emotional ailments of his characters, reflecting the era's concerns about health and individuality. This unique vantage point likely motivated him to capture the nuances of human behavior within the confines of a seemingly innocent social event. Readers seeking a profound yet entertaining exploration of character dynamics will find "A Madeira Party" refreshing and compelling. Mitchell's blend of humor and keen insight into the human condition makes this work an essential addition for anyone interested in the intersections of literature and psychology during a transformative era.
